新聞中心
在現(xiàn)代信息化時(shí)代,數(shù)據(jù)已成為企業(yè)和組織的核心資產(chǎn)。隨著業(yè)務(wù)規(guī)模不斷擴(kuò)大,海量數(shù)據(jù)的存儲(chǔ)、管理和分析問(wèn)題已成為大家不得不面對(duì)的挑戰(zhàn)。因此,如何選擇高效可靠的數(shù)據(jù)庫(kù)管理系統(tǒng)顯得尤為重要。本文將重點(diǎn)介紹如何選擇數(shù)據(jù)庫(kù)管理海量數(shù)據(jù)。

成都創(chuàng)新互聯(lián)專注為客戶提供全方位的互聯(lián)網(wǎng)綜合服務(wù),包含不限于成都做網(wǎng)站、網(wǎng)站設(shè)計(jì)、外貿(mào)營(yíng)銷網(wǎng)站建設(shè)、龍子湖網(wǎng)絡(luò)推廣、微信小程序、龍子湖網(wǎng)絡(luò)營(yíng)銷、龍子湖企業(yè)策劃、龍子湖品牌公關(guān)、搜索引擎seo、人物專訪、企業(yè)宣傳片、企業(yè)代運(yùn)營(yíng)等,從售前售中售后,我們都將竭誠(chéng)為您服務(wù),您的肯定,是我們最大的嘉獎(jiǎng);成都創(chuàng)新互聯(lián)為所有大學(xué)生創(chuàng)業(yè)者提供龍子湖建站搭建服務(wù),24小時(shí)服務(wù)熱線:18980820575,官方網(wǎng)址:www.cdcxhl.com
一、了解常見(jiàn)的數(shù)據(jù)庫(kù)類型
在選擇數(shù)據(jù)庫(kù)之前,首先需要了解常見(jiàn)的數(shù)據(jù)庫(kù)類型,以便選擇最適合企業(yè)需求的數(shù)據(jù)庫(kù)系統(tǒng)。常見(jiàn)的數(shù)據(jù)庫(kù)類型如下:
1.關(guān)系型數(shù)據(jù)庫(kù):如MySQL、Oracle、SQLServer等,適用于大多數(shù)應(yīng)用場(chǎng)景,具備豐富的功能和高性能。
2.列式存儲(chǔ)數(shù)據(jù)庫(kù):如HBase、Cassandra等,適用于處理非結(jié)構(gòu)化或半結(jié)構(gòu)化數(shù)據(jù),如文本、圖片、視頻等。
3.文檔型數(shù)據(jù)庫(kù):如MongoDB、CouchDB等,適用于處理大量半結(jié)構(gòu)化數(shù)據(jù),如日志、事件等。
4.圖形數(shù)據(jù)庫(kù):如Neo4j、OrientDB等,適用于存儲(chǔ)和處理多種復(fù)雜的圖形數(shù)據(jù)。
二、了解數(shù)據(jù)庫(kù)的性能指標(biāo)
為了選擇適合企業(yè)的數(shù)據(jù)庫(kù),需要了解數(shù)據(jù)庫(kù)的性能指標(biāo),包括:
1.性能:數(shù)據(jù)庫(kù)處理數(shù)據(jù)的速度和吞吐量。
2.可伸縮性:數(shù)據(jù)庫(kù)處理大量數(shù)據(jù)時(shí),可以通過(guò)增加計(jì)算和存儲(chǔ)資源實(shí)現(xiàn)擴(kuò)展性。
3.安全性:數(shù)據(jù)庫(kù)提供的安全機(jī)制,包括用戶管理、訪問(wèn)授權(quán)、數(shù)據(jù)加密等。
4.穩(wěn)定性:數(shù)據(jù)庫(kù)系統(tǒng)的可靠性和故障恢復(fù)能力。
5.成本:數(shù)據(jù)庫(kù)的購(gòu)買成本、維護(hù)成本、擴(kuò)展成本等。
三、考慮數(shù)據(jù)規(guī)模和業(yè)務(wù)需求
在選擇數(shù)據(jù)庫(kù)管理海量數(shù)據(jù)時(shí),需要考慮實(shí)際的數(shù)據(jù)規(guī)模和業(yè)務(wù)需求。比如,如果數(shù)據(jù)規(guī)模較小,可以選擇傳統(tǒng)的關(guān)系型數(shù)據(jù)庫(kù);如果數(shù)據(jù)規(guī)模較大,可以選擇分布式數(shù)據(jù)庫(kù);如果需要處理半結(jié)構(gòu)化數(shù)據(jù),可以選擇文檔型數(shù)據(jù)庫(kù)等。
同時(shí),還需要根據(jù)業(yè)務(wù)需求考慮是否需要支持復(fù)雜查詢、事務(wù)處理、數(shù)據(jù)分析等功能。如果需要支持這些功能,需要選擇具備高性能和可擴(kuò)展性的數(shù)據(jù)庫(kù)系統(tǒng)。
四、考慮并發(fā)讀寫能力
在高并發(fā)讀寫場(chǎng)景下,需要選擇具備高并發(fā)讀寫能力的數(shù)據(jù)庫(kù)系統(tǒng)。數(shù)據(jù)庫(kù)的并發(fā)讀寫能力主要包括以下幾個(gè)方面:
1.連接池:連接池管理連接的數(shù)量,控制并發(fā)讀寫量,提高數(shù)據(jù)庫(kù)的并發(fā)讀寫能力。
2.緩存:采用緩存技術(shù)可以減輕數(shù)據(jù)庫(kù)的壓力,提高讀寫效率。
3.索引:設(shè)計(jì)合理的索引可以提高查詢效率,減少數(shù)據(jù)庫(kù)的讀取操作。
四、考慮數(shù)據(jù)庫(kù)的安全性
數(shù)據(jù)安全是所有數(shù)據(jù)庫(kù)管理系統(tǒng)中最關(guān)鍵和最重要的部分。數(shù)據(jù)存儲(chǔ)敏感,需要考慮以下幾個(gè)安全因素:
1.數(shù)據(jù)備份和恢復(fù):數(shù)據(jù)庫(kù)備份和系統(tǒng)重建是防止數(shù)據(jù)丟失的最重要措施之一。
2.權(quán)限管理和訪問(wèn)控制:針對(duì)不同的角色和權(quán)限設(shè)置不同的訪問(wèn)權(quán)限,以保障數(shù)據(jù)的安全性。
3.網(wǎng)絡(luò)安全和數(shù)據(jù)傳輸:采用加密傳輸和安全協(xié)議可以保障數(shù)據(jù)庫(kù)的安全。
五、結(jié)合具體業(yè)務(wù)需求選擇
需要根據(jù)具體業(yè)務(wù)需求來(lái)選擇最適合企業(yè)的數(shù)據(jù)庫(kù)。選擇數(shù)據(jù)庫(kù)要綜合考慮性能、可擴(kuò)展性、穩(wěn)定性、安全性等因素,并結(jié)合具體業(yè)務(wù)需求作出決策。
選擇一款適合企業(yè)需求的數(shù)據(jù)庫(kù)管理系統(tǒng)是一個(gè)需要花費(fèi)時(shí)間和精力的過(guò)程。需要考慮多個(gè)因素,做出綜合權(quán)衡之后才能選擇出最適合企業(yè)的數(shù)據(jù)庫(kù)系統(tǒng)。希望本文能對(duì)讀者選擇數(shù)據(jù)庫(kù)管理海量數(shù)據(jù)有所幫助。
成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ián)為您提供網(wǎng)站建設(shè)、網(wǎng)站制作、網(wǎng)頁(yè)設(shè)計(jì)及定制高端網(wǎng)站建設(shè)服務(wù)!
什么是常用的三個(gè)數(shù)據(jù)庫(kù)?
目前,數(shù)據(jù)庫(kù)管理系統(tǒng)關(guān)系型數(shù)據(jù)庫(kù)為主導(dǎo)產(chǎn)品的商品化,技術(shù)相對(duì)成熟。雖然面向?qū)ο蟮臄?shù)據(jù)庫(kù)管理系統(tǒng)的先進(jìn)技術(shù),數(shù)據(jù)庫(kù)易于開(kāi)發(fā),維護(hù),但尚未成熟的產(chǎn)品。國(guó)際和國(guó)內(nèi)領(lǐng)先的關(guān)系數(shù)據(jù)庫(kù)管理系統(tǒng),甲骨文,Sybase,Informix和INGRES。這些產(chǎn)品支持多種平臺(tái),如UNIX,VMS,Windows上,而不是同一級(jí)別的支持。和成熟的IBM的DB2關(guān)系數(shù)據(jù)庫(kù)。但是,DB2是內(nèi)嵌于IBM的AS/400系列機(jī),只支持OS/400操作系統(tǒng)。
?1.MySQL
?MySQL是更受歡迎的開(kāi)源SQL數(shù)據(jù)庫(kù)管理系統(tǒng),由MySQL AB公司,發(fā)布和支持。 MySQL AB是基于MySQL開(kāi)發(fā)一個(gè)商業(yè)公司,它是利用與開(kāi)源值相結(jié)合的一個(gè)成功的商業(yè)模式?和方法論的第二代開(kāi)源公司。 MySQL是MySQL AB的注冊(cè)商標(biāo)。
?MySQL是一個(gè)快速,多線程,多用戶和健壯的SQL數(shù)據(jù)庫(kù)服務(wù)器。 MySQL服務(wù)器支持關(guān)鍵任務(wù),重負(fù)載生產(chǎn)系統(tǒng)的使用,它可以嵌入到一個(gè)大配置(大規(guī)模部署)軟件。
?的MySQL與其他數(shù)據(jù)庫(kù)管理系統(tǒng)相比,具有以下優(yōu)點(diǎn):
?(1)MySQL是一個(gè)關(guān)系數(shù)據(jù)庫(kù)管理系統(tǒng)。
?(2)MySQL是開(kāi)源。
?(3)MySQL服務(wù)器是一個(gè)快速,可靠和易于使用的數(shù)據(jù)庫(kù)服務(wù)器。
?(4)在MySQL服務(wù)器的客戶機(jī)/服務(wù)器或嵌入式系統(tǒng)。
?(5)可以使用MySQL軟件。
2.SQL Server的嗎?
?SQL Server是由微軟開(kāi)發(fā)的數(shù)據(jù)庫(kù)管理系統(tǒng),是目前更流行的數(shù)據(jù)庫(kù),用于存儲(chǔ)在網(wǎng)絡(luò)上的數(shù)據(jù),它已被廣泛用于電子商務(wù),銀行,保險(xiǎn),電力和其他數(shù)據(jù)庫(kù)相關(guān)的產(chǎn)業(yè)。
?SQL Server 2023的最新版本,它只能在Windows作業(yè)系統(tǒng)的穩(wěn)定運(yùn)行是非常重要的數(shù)據(jù)庫(kù)。并行實(shí)施和共存模型并不成熟,這是很難對(duì)付越來(lái)越多的用戶和數(shù)據(jù)量是有限的,可擴(kuò)展性。
?SQL Server提供了網(wǎng)絡(luò)和電子商務(wù)功能,如豐富的XML和Internet標(biāo)準(zhǔn)的支持,輕松且安全地通過(guò)Web訪問(wèn)的數(shù)據(jù)的范圍很廣,有一個(gè)強(qiáng)大,靈活和網(wǎng)絡(luò),基于安全和應(yīng)用管理。此外,由于它的易用性和友好的用戶界面,通過(guò)廣大用戶的好評(píng),。
?3.Oracle
?提出的數(shù)據(jù)庫(kù),該公司首先想到的,通常是甲骨文(Oracle)。該公司成立于1977年,原是一個(gè)專門開(kāi)發(fā)的數(shù)據(jù)庫(kù)公司。甲骨文一直在數(shù)據(jù)庫(kù)領(lǐng)域的領(lǐng)導(dǎo)者。 1984年,之一個(gè)關(guān)系數(shù)據(jù)庫(kù)轉(zhuǎn)移到一臺(tái)臺(tái)式電腦。然后,Oracle5率先推出的分布式數(shù)據(jù)庫(kù),客戶機(jī)/服務(wù)器體系結(jié)構(gòu)的新概念。甲骨文公司的之一行鎖定模式和對(duì)稱多處理計(jì)算機(jī)的支持……最新的Oracle對(duì)象技術(shù),李仿成為關(guān)系 – 對(duì)象數(shù)據(jù)庫(kù)系統(tǒng)。目前,甲骨文的產(chǎn)品涵蓋了幾十個(gè)型號(hào)的大,中,小型機(jī),Oracle數(shù)據(jù)庫(kù)已成為世界上使用最廣泛的關(guān)系數(shù)據(jù)。
Oracle數(shù)據(jù)庫(kù)產(chǎn)品具有以下優(yōu)良特性。
?(一)兼容性
?Oracle產(chǎn)品使用標(biāo)準(zhǔn)的SQL,和美國(guó)國(guó)家標(biāo)準(zhǔn)技術(shù)局(NIST)測(cè)試后。兼容IBM的SQL / DS,DB2中,安格爾的IDMS / R。
?(2)可移植性
??甲骨文的產(chǎn)品,可以廣泛的硬件仔培和操作系統(tǒng)平臺(tái)上運(yùn)行。可以安裝在超過(guò)70種大不同,VMS系統(tǒng)的DOS,UNIX上,Windows和其他操作系統(tǒng),小型機(jī);
?(3)協(xié)會(huì)
甲骨文與各種通信網(wǎng)絡(luò)連接,支持各種協(xié)議(TCP / IP協(xié)議說(shuō),DECnet,LU6.2工作等)。?
?(4)高生產(chǎn)率
?Oracle提供了多種開(kāi)發(fā)工具,可以極大地方便進(jìn)一步的發(fā)展。
?(5)開(kāi)放
?Oracle的兼容性,可移植性,連接性和高生產(chǎn)念擾唯力的Oracle RDBMS具有良好的開(kāi)放性。
?4.Sybase
?馬克B. Hiffman和羅伯特·愛(ài)潑斯坦,1984年,創(chuàng)建了Sybase公司,并于1987年推出了Sybase數(shù)據(jù)庫(kù)產(chǎn)品。 SYBASE主要有三種版本:一是UNIX操作系統(tǒng)版本下運(yùn)行的Novell Netware環(huán)境下運(yùn)行的版本; Windows NT環(huán)境下運(yùn)行的版本。 UNIX操作系統(tǒng),目前應(yīng)用最廣泛使用的SCO UNIX SYBASE 10 SYABSE- 11。
??的Sybase數(shù)據(jù)庫(kù)的特點(diǎn):
?(1)它是基于客戶機(jī)/服務(wù)器體系結(jié)構(gòu)的數(shù)據(jù)庫(kù)。
?(2)它是真正開(kāi)放的數(shù)據(jù)庫(kù)。
?(3)它是一種高性能的數(shù)據(jù)庫(kù)。
?5.DB2
?DB2是內(nèi)嵌在IBM的AS/400系統(tǒng)的數(shù)據(jù)庫(kù)管理系統(tǒng),直接從硬件支持。它支持標(biāo)準(zhǔn)的SQL語(yǔ)言,異構(gòu)數(shù)據(jù)庫(kù)連接的網(wǎng)關(guān)。因此,它具有速度快,可靠性好等優(yōu)點(diǎn)。但是,只有硬件平臺(tái)選擇了IBM的AS/400,可以選擇使用DB2數(shù)據(jù)庫(kù)管理系統(tǒng)。
?DB2可以運(yùn)行在所有主要平臺(tái)(包括Windows),最適于海量數(shù)據(jù)。
?DB2是使用最廣泛的企業(yè)級(jí),而國(guó)內(nèi)約5%,在1997年,在世界更大的500家企業(yè),近85%的DB2數(shù)據(jù)庫(kù)服務(wù)器。
?此外,微軟的Access數(shù)據(jù)庫(kù),F(xiàn)oxPro數(shù)據(jù)庫(kù)。現(xiàn)在有這么多的數(shù)據(jù)庫(kù)系統(tǒng),在游戲中進(jìn)行編程,應(yīng)該選擇什么樣的數(shù)據(jù)庫(kù)?首要的原則,根據(jù)實(shí)際需要,另一方面,考慮游戲開(kāi)發(fā)預(yù)算。現(xiàn)在常用的數(shù)據(jù)庫(kù):SQL Server中,我的SQL,甲骨文,F(xiàn)oxPro的。 MySQL是一個(gè)免費(fèi)的數(shù)據(jù)庫(kù)系統(tǒng),其功能與一個(gè)標(biāo)準(zhǔn)的數(shù)據(jù)庫(kù)功能,因此,建議使用獨(dú)立制片人。甲骨文雖然功能強(qiáng)大,但它是用于商業(yè)用途,是目前在比賽中很少使用。
GenBank數(shù)據(jù)庫(kù), EST數(shù)據(jù)庫(kù)跡脊,UniGene數(shù)據(jù)庫(kù)
fasta格式的特征是什么?序列文件的之一行是由大于號(hào)”>”或分號(hào)”;”打頭的任意文字說(shuō)明鏈州拆(習(xí)慣常用”>”作為起始),用與序列標(biāo)記。
UniProt的序列有哪兩類?分為兩個(gè)部分:來(lái)源于實(shí)驗(yàn)的有詳細(xì)注釋的序列(SwissProt)和自動(dòng)注釋序列(TrEMBL)
預(yù)棚棗測(cè)蛋白三維結(jié)構(gòu)可以參考哪個(gè)數(shù)據(jù)庫(kù)?UniPROT數(shù)據(jù)庫(kù)
MY SQL Oracle 和 SQL server
關(guān)于海量數(shù)據(jù) 選用什么數(shù)據(jù)庫(kù)的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。
香港云服務(wù)器機(jī)房,創(chuàng)新互聯(lián)(www.cdcxhl.com)專業(yè)云服務(wù)器廠商,回大陸優(yōu)化帶寬,安全/穩(wěn)定/低延遲.創(chuàng)新互聯(lián)助力企業(yè)出海業(yè)務(wù),提供一站式解決方案。香港服務(wù)器-免備案低延遲-雙向CN2+BGP極速互訪!
當(dāng)前題目:如何選擇數(shù)據(jù)庫(kù)管理海量數(shù)據(jù)?(海量數(shù)據(jù)選用什么數(shù)據(jù)庫(kù))
網(wǎng)站路徑:http://www.fisionsoft.com.cn/article/coicgjj.html


咨詢
建站咨詢
